What is a Light Buddy System?
A light buddy system is a strategic setup involving lighting tools and techniques used to augment safety and visibility during outdoor activities. These systems are particularly vital for activities conducted in low-light environments, such as night hiking, camping, or cave exploration.
Key Components of a Light Buddy System
- Headlamps: Essential for hands-free illumination, allowing users to navigate and perform tasks without holding a flashlight.
- Signal Lights: Used for communication and signaling across distances, crucial in emergency situations.
- Portable Lanterns: Provide ambient light, ideal for campsite settings to ensure broader area illumination.
- Backup Batteries: Critical for maintaining power, especially during extended trips.

Types of Light Buddy Systems
Choosing the right type of light buddy system depends on the specific needs of the adventure and the environment. Here are some common types:
Basic Systems
Comprising essential items like headlamps and flashlights, basic systems are suitable for short trips and familiar terrains.
- Ideal for day hikes that extend into dusk.
- Suitable for beginners venturing into outdoor activities.
Advanced Systems
Advanced systems incorporate more sophisticated tools like GPS-equipped lights and solar-powered lanterns, catering to longer and more challenging expeditions.
- Best for multi-day treks and remote explorations.
- Includes advanced features for enhanced functionality.

How to Choose the Right Light Buddy System
When selecting a light buddy system, consider the following factors:
- Activity Type: Tailor the system to match the specific activity and environment.
- Duration: Ensure the system can sustain lighting for the entire duration of the trip.
- Weight and Portability: Opt for lightweight and portable systems for ease of transport.
- Weather Resistance: Choose systems that can withstand adverse weather conditions.
